#include <stdio.h>
#include <unistd.h>
#include <fcntl.h>
#include <sys/socket.h>
#include <sys/types.h>
#include <arpa/inet.h>
#include "socket.h"
int socket_server(uint32_t port)
{
printf("Creating a socket with port %d...\n", port);
/* Server socket */
struct sockaddr_in server_address = {0};
server_address.sin_addr.s_addr = htonl(INADDR_ANY);
server_address.sin_family = AF_INET;
server_address.sin_port = port;
int server_sock = socket(AF_INET, SOCK_STREAM, 0);
if (server_sock == -1)
{
perror("[socket_server] socket");
return -1;
}
if (bind(server_sock, (struct sockaddr *)&server_address, sizeof(server_address)) == -1)
{
perror("[socket_server] bind");
close(server_sock);
return -1;
}
if (listen(server_sock, 5) == -1)
{
perror("[socket_server] listen");
close(server_sock);
return -1;
}
/* Client socket */
struct sockaddr_in client_address;
socklen_t client_address_len = sizeof(client_address);
int client_sock = accept(server_sock, (struct sockaddr *)&client_address, &client_address_len);
if (client_sock == -1)
{
perror("[socket_server] accept");
close(server_sock);
return -1;
}
// /* Make client socket non-blocking */
// int flag = fcntl(client_sock, F_GETFL, 0);
// fcntl(client_sock, F_SETFL, flag | O_NONBLOCK);
/* Finalize */
close(server_sock);
printf("Connection established.\n");
return client_sock;
}
int socket_client(char address[], uint32_t port)
{
printf("Creating a socket with address %s:%d...\n", address, port);
struct sockaddr_in server_address = {0};
server_address.sin_addr.s_addr = inet_addr(address);
server_address.sin_family = AF_INET;
server_address.sin_port = port;
int sock = socket(AF_INET, SOCK_STREAM, 0);
if (sock == -1)
{
perror("[socket_client] socket");
return -1;
}
if (connect(sock, (struct sockaddr *)&server_address, sizeof(server_address)) == -1)
{
perror("[socket_client] connect");
close(sock);
return -1;
}
printf("Connection established.\n");
return sock;
}
